随着区块链技术的不断发展,Web3钱包成为了用户与去中心化应用(DApp)之间的桥梁。在这个过程中,许多用户可能会面临将他们的钱包授权给一些未知或不明项目的情况。这种做法虽然可能带来某些便利,但也潜藏着巨大的风险。为了帮助用户更好地理解这一主题,我们将深入探讨Web3钱包授权未知项目的挑战、潜在风险、以及最佳实践。
Web3钱包的基本概念
Web3钱包是在区块链生态系统中用于存储和管理加密货币和数字资产的工具。与传统的钱包不同,Web3钱包不仅允许用户发送和接收加密货币,还可以与智能合约和去中心化应用进行交互。这种钱包通常具备私钥管理、身份验证、签名交易等功能,是用户在去中心化经济中参与活动的关键工具。
未知项目的定义与特点
在区块链领域,未知项目一般指的是那些尚未获得广泛认可或没有显著声誉的去中心化应用或服务。这些项目可能刚刚启动,或者仅在特定的社群中得到关注。通常情况下,未知项目的特点包括:
- 缺乏透明度:许多未知项目没有清晰的团队背景、发展路线或财务透明度。
- 高风险:由于缺乏信任度,未知项目往往伴随着更高的投资风险,可能会导致资金损失。
- 缺乏社区支持:成熟项目通常拥有活跃的社区支持,而未知项目往往缺少足够的用户基础来提供反馈和支持。
Web3钱包授权的流程
在使用Web3钱包与去中心化应用进行交互时,用户常常需要进行授权以便允许应用访问其钱包内的资产和信息。这个过程通常包括以下几个步骤:
- 连接钱包:用户在DApp界面上选择“连接钱包”并选择相应的Web3钱包,如MetaMask、Trust Wallet等。
- 选择账户:用户需要选择要授权的账户,这通常是他们在钱包中的地址。
- 授权请求:DApp会发送授权请求,用户需要仔细查看请求的内容,包括允许访问的权限和操作。
- 签名交易:用户确认后,需使用私钥签名该交易,从而完成授权。此时,访问权限将被授予该DApp。
授权未知项目的风险
虽然用户在与某些未知项目互动时可能会感受到新颖和刺激,但也要意识到潜在的大量风险:
- 产权风险:授权可能将用户的私钥暴露给不可信的智能合约,造成资产被盗。
- 不明操作:未知项目可能会进行不透明操作,导致用户对其资产的控制降低。
- 诈骗与钓鱼攻击:一些未知项目可能通过伪装成合法项目来诱骗用户授权,从而实施诈骗。
如何安全授权DApp
尽管未知项目风险较高,但一些用户仍可能愿意尝试。以下是安全授权DApp的一些最佳实践:
- 进行充分的研究:在授权任何未知项目之前,用户应进行详细的背景调查,了解该项目的开发者和社区反馈。
- 使用小额资金:为降低风险,用户可以选择只用小额资金进行尝试,以免造成重大损失。
- 审查智能合约:如果可能,邀请开发者或专家审核智能合约代码,以识别潜在漏洞。
- 设置限额:在授权过程中,尽量设置权限的限额,以免资产受到较大损失。
相关问题讨论
1. Web3钱包授权的安全性如何提高?
要提高Web3钱包授权的安全性,用户可以采取以下几个步骤:
- 使用硬件钱包:硬件钱包相对安全,因为其私钥存储在物理设备上,与互联网隔离。这会降低向不可信应用授权时的风险。
- 安全审计:参与审查项目的安全性,可以通过去中心化审计平台找到专家和社区支持的项目,提高审核质素。
- 保持信息更新:密切关注行业动态,特别是网络安全事件和攻击案例,以便及时调整钱包和授权安全策略。
- 选择知名项目:了解什么是“知名”,例如项目是否拥有活跃的社区、开发者声誉及技术专业背景等。
除了以上措施,用户还应定期检查已授权的DApp,及时撤销不再使用或感觉不安全的授权,以保护其资产安全。
2. 什么是智能合约审计,如何寻找可靠的审计公司?
智能合约审计是对合约代码进行系统性测试与审核的过程,目的是识别潜在的安全漏洞和逻辑错误。以下是找寻可靠审计公司的建议:
- 行业声誉:选择在行业内有良好声誉的审计公司,通常可以通过社区反馈和项目推荐来判断。
- 过往审核案例:关注审计公司的过往案例,确保其审计能力得到多个项目的认可。
- 专业团队:研究审计公司的团队背景,确保其拥有足够的技术实力和资质认证。
- 审核过程透明:选择审核过程透明的公司,确保过程中的每一步都有记录,包括发现的问题和处理建议。
选择合适的审计公司可以在很大程度上提高项目的安全性,降低用户的风险。
3. 去中心化金融(DeFi)项目的风险有哪些?
去中心化金融项目自诞生以来,已经吸引了大量投资,但它们所伴随的风险同样不容忽视:
- 智能合约风险:智能合约中的逻辑错误或编码漏洞可能会引发不可逆转的资金损失,用户在使用DeFi项目时需谨慎。
- 流动性风险:一些DeFi项目可能会因为流动性不足导致用户难以完成投资或取款,造成资金锁定。
- 市场波动风险:加密资产的市场波动性极大,投资者需做好心里准备,避免因价格波动造成损失。
- 治理风险:部分去中心化金融项目的决策权掌握在少数开发者或基金会手中,可能导致治理失效或存在利益冲突。
投资者在参与DeFi项目时,应充分理解这些风险,并做好相应的风险管理措施。
4. 如果我的Web3钱包被盗,我该如何处理?
如果发现Web3钱包被盗,用户应立即采取如下步骤:
- 更改密码与恢复助记词:首先,立即修改与钱包相关的所有密码,并恢复钱包助记词以防被重新控制。
- 通知服务提供商:联系钱包提供商或相关服务,告知他们账户被盗的情况,寻求帮助。
- 冻结账户:考虑冻结相关账户,以防止黑客继续进行任何操作,尽可能保护剩余资产。
- 报警:如果盗取金额较大,应尽快报警,虽然追回资产的可能性不高,但有助于未来的安全防范。
- 学习经验教训:回顾如何丢失钱包,分析潜在漏洞,以便改进下次的安全措施,确保避免类似的安全问题。
虽然被盗事件非常令人沮丧,但及时采取补救措施可以在一定程度上减轻损失,继续开展加密资产的管理。
综上所述,Web3钱包的授权是一个复杂而重要的过程,用户在享受去中心化生态系统带来的便利的同时,也必须保持警惕,以保护自己的资产安全。通过深入研究和了解相关风险与最佳实践,用户能够在这个充满机遇和挑战的环境中更加从容地进行决策。